I am er-pr-her2+++. DCIS. Nodes negative. No mets. I am almost finished with my treatments. I had a partial masectomy, needed a second surgery to clear margins. Had 6 rounds of Taxotere, carboplatin, along with Herceptin. Herceptin was given with the chemo every three weeks, but herceptin will continue for one year total. After chemo, had radiation for 6 weeks. I only have two herceptin left and will get my port removed one week later.

You are a special guy to be your wife's advocate. Everything can be quite confusing when you are first diagnosed.

The first thing that needs to happen is the staging of your wife's disease. The treatment protocol varies by the severity of her disease. Since her sentinel node was positive, I believe she will be at least stage 2.

I am also ER-/PR-/HER2 positive. But it was over 6 years ago when I was first diagnosed. So what they used on me back then may not be what they will recommend for your wife. They know now that chemo works better on ER-/PR- than it does on ER+/PR+ which is a positive for your wife. But they still have no idea what feeds ER-/PR- tumors and have no drugs other than chemo to treat that aspect of our tumor. Fortunately, your wife is HER2 positive. Knowledge of HER2 breast cancer has advanced a lot in the past six year and there are many new drugs on the market and in clinical trial to target HER2.

One thing that I do recommend to anyone facing chemo is to have a port installed unless you have very good veins. I wish someone would have told me to do this. It makes receiving the chemo so much easier. Talk to your wife's doctor about it before she gets started and see what he/she thinks. It is a simple outpatient procedure to put it in and then take it out when treatment is completed.
